Fordham Gabelli Question

I got accepted to Gabelli in their Global Business Honors Program. I also got a full scholarship. I have great stats (1550 SAT and straight As) and expect to get into a couple of highly ranked schools. However, the Gabelli honors program sounds cool (only 20 students each year) and free college is awesome. Should I seriously consider this or just go to a higher ranked school and suck up the $50k or so in tuition each year (my parents can afford that). Does the honors program help at all in job placement? Thanks.
